C# 클래스 Owin.Scim.Repository.InMemory.InMemoryUserRepository

상속: IUserRepository
파일 보기 프로젝트 열기: PowerDMS/Owin.Scim

공개 메소드들

메소드 설명
CreateUser ( ScimUser user ) : Task
DeleteUser ( string userId ) : System.Threading.Tasks.Task
GetUser ( string userId ) : Task
InMemoryUserRepository ( ScimServerConfiguration scimServerConfiguration, IGroupRepository groupRepository ) : System
IsUserNameAvailable ( string userName ) : Task
QueryUsers ( ScimQueryOptions options ) : Task>
UpdateUser ( ScimUser user ) : Task
UserExists ( string userId ) : Task

메소드 상세

CreateUser() 공개 메소드

public CreateUser ( ScimUser user ) : Task
user ScimUser
리턴 Task

DeleteUser() 공개 메소드

public DeleteUser ( string userId ) : System.Threading.Tasks.Task
userId string
리턴 System.Threading.Tasks.Task

GetUser() 공개 메소드

public GetUser ( string userId ) : Task
userId string
리턴 Task

InMemoryUserRepository() 공개 메소드

public InMemoryUserRepository ( ScimServerConfiguration scimServerConfiguration, IGroupRepository groupRepository ) : System
scimServerConfiguration ScimServerConfiguration
groupRepository IGroupRepository
리턴 System

IsUserNameAvailable() 공개 메소드

public IsUserNameAvailable ( string userName ) : Task
userName string
리턴 Task

QueryUsers() 공개 메소드

public QueryUsers ( ScimQueryOptions options ) : Task>
options ScimQueryOptions
리턴 Task>

UpdateUser() 공개 메소드

public UpdateUser ( ScimUser user ) : Task
user ScimUser
리턴 Task

UserExists() 공개 메소드

public UserExists ( string userId ) : Task
userId string
리턴 Task